With ongoing advancements in power systems and design, roller screeds remain a dependable tool for boosting efficiency on modern jobsites. Unlike traditional boards or vibrating screed systems, roller screeds use a rotating tube to strike off concrete with consistent compaction and surface quality all without the fatigue or variability that comes with hand-pulling or wet screeds.

As manufacturers refine power options and design versatility, choosing the right screed for your work comes down to understanding how you pour, not just what you pour. Whether you’re a contractor tackling daily flatwork, a farmer pouring bins and pads, or a municipality maintaining sidewalks and approaches, here’s how the latest generation of roller screeds stack up for 2026.

For Agriculture: Simple, Reliable, and Built to Last

Farmers and ranchers often pour concrete less frequently but expect their tools to perform when called upon. Their jobs tend to span from grain bin pads to feed alleys and shop floors. Reliability and ease of use matter more than maximum output.

Top Considerations:

  • Minimal maintenance
  • Quick setup with small crews
  • Portability and storage convenience

Best Fits:

  • Battery powered screeds shine here. With no cords, hoses, or engine maintenance, they’re ideal for operations that value convenience. A single battery charge can typically handle up to 2,500 sq. ft., which covers most on-farm applications.
battery batt on screed grain bin
  • For farms already using skid steers or tractors, hydraulic powered screeds can be practical — though they require more setup.

Bottom Line:


Battery power is becoming the clear winner for farmers — portable, quiet, and dependable for smaller crews and remote pours.

For Municipalities: Reliability and Crew Versatility

Municipal crews maintain everything from sidewalks and approaches to culverts and crosswalks, often working in areas where safety, cleanup time, and intuitive operation are key concerns.

Top Considerations:

  • Ease of use for varied operators
  • Low emissions and noise for public spaces
  • Durability for frequent use

Best Fits:

  • Electric and battery powered screeds offer the best combination of safety and simplicity. Battery models allow quick setup with minimal training, while plug-in electric models are dependable for short, controlled pours like sidewalks.

  • Hydraulic screeds serve well for large-scale municipal projects like drainage ditches or road approaches, especially when integrated with existing equipment fleets.

Bottom Line:


Municipal buyers should prioritize user-friendly power sources and portability over raw output. Electric and battery systems reduce training barriers while ensuring consistent results across rotating crews.

Gas roller screeds require ongoing fuel purchases and typically have a two-to-four-year lifespan with weekly use. They are commonly used in residential, municipal, agricultural, commercial, and specialty applications such as DOT and pervious concrete. Strengths include portability and medium weight, with considerations of engine maintenance, noise and emissions, transportation, and the need for level operation. Battery roller screeds require investment in batteries and chargers and have a similar two-to-four-year lifespan with weekly use. They are frequently used in residential, municipal, commercial, and specialty applications including DOT, pervious, and sloped work. Strengths include cordless portability, fast setup and cleanup, and minimal maintenance, with considerations of battery run time and charging time. Electric plug-in roller screeds have the lowest initial investment and a one-to-three-year lifespan with weekly use. They are commonly used by residential users, small contractors, municipalities, and economy-focused buyers. Strengths include consistent power, no emissions, and low maintenance, with considerations of required power access and cord management or damage. Hydraulic roller screeds have the highest initial investment, the lowest maintenance requirements, and a five-to-ten-year lifespan with weekly use. They are most often used by DOT contractors, commercial contractors, and specialty contractors. Strengths include the highest torque and the ability to handle the longest pours, with considerations of required hydraulic power sources, hose management, equipment weight, and setup time.
